對標華為鴻蒙,小米物聯網系統(tǒng)Vela來了!
自從谷歌禁止華為使用GMS 開始,華為鴻蒙系統(tǒng)已經發(fā)展兩年多。最近,鴻蒙系統(tǒng)又多了新的伙伴,在小米開發(fā)者大會上,小米AIoT戰(zhàn)略委員會主席、IoT平臺部總經理范典發(fā)表演講,宣布小米將研發(fā)全新的物聯網操作系統(tǒng)Vela。
按照小米官方的說法,小米物聯網系統(tǒng)可以打通碎片化的IoT應用,支持高性價比的MCU設備,可以原生支持小米妙享功能。手表,手環(huán),音箱,智能家電,相機ISP、傳感器這些硬件未來都能互聯互通,融入一個完整的操作系統(tǒng)中。
▲ 小米Vela
小米突然爆出研發(fā)操作系統(tǒng)的消息,未免有些出人意料。不過仔細想一下,小米的做法也在情理之中。消費電子領域,操作系統(tǒng)的重要性毋庸置疑,蘋果憑借iOS、macOS系統(tǒng)吸引無數忠實擁躉,微軟、谷歌也借助Windows、安卓系統(tǒng)穩(wěn)居行業(yè)龍頭。
如今的消費電子領域,Windows、macOS瓜分桌面操作系統(tǒng)市場,iOS、安卓共同壟斷手機操作系統(tǒng)市場,后來者幾乎無機可乘。對于后進者來說,打破僵局的關鍵在于5G 物聯網。眾所周知,5G 的重要特性就是萬物互聯,這些零碎的物聯網產品也需要一個統(tǒng)一的系統(tǒng)來連接。華為抓住這個機會,推出基于分布式技術的鴻蒙操作系統(tǒng)。而作為早早發(fā)力AIOT 領域的小米自然不敢落后,這才推出物聯網軟件平臺小米Vela。
何為物聯網操作系統(tǒng)
說起操作系統(tǒng),絕大多數小伙伴對此都非常熟悉,手機、電腦都通過操作系統(tǒng)來實現各種桌面應用,所有的操作與反饋都依賴于此,一般來說,每一部手機或電腦都配備一個操作系統(tǒng),少數電腦會同時安裝兩個及兩個以上操作系統(tǒng)。
然而,對于物聯網操作系統(tǒng)來說,這種定義并不準確。物聯網大致可以分為感知層、網絡層、設備管理層、應用層等四個層次。其中感知層以各種各樣的傳感器、網關、智能終端、智能卡等組成。這些終端設備運算能力參差不齊,有的可以安裝復雜系統(tǒng),有的只能進行簡單計算,在這些感知設備中不可能安裝相同的系統(tǒng)。
因此,物聯網操作系統(tǒng)實際上是一種嵌入式系統(tǒng),具有專一功能與實時計算性能。簡單來說,物聯網系統(tǒng)會根據不同的設備做定制化嵌入式系統(tǒng),這些操作系統(tǒng)需要的內存空間往往很小,平時只進行專一的簡單計算。
▲ 小米Vela系統(tǒng)基于NuttX打造
小米Vela系統(tǒng),本質上也是NuttX實時嵌入式操作系統(tǒng)的改進版。NuttX在設計之初就考慮到了對應用較為廣泛的Linux的兼容、并對POSIX原生支持,在過去幾年里也可見看到索尼、三星等大廠先后加入了這一陣營,因而可以將NuttX操作系統(tǒng)看做物聯網領域的安卓系統(tǒng),小米Vela不過是在此基礎上稍作改進。
物聯網系統(tǒng)是大勢所趨
單從功能上來說,物聯網操作系統(tǒng)不像手機操作系統(tǒng)那樣復雜,開發(fā)起來簡單許多。另一方面,物聯網的實質在于萬物互聯,物聯網操作系統(tǒng)可以在5G 時代提供智能終端一體化能力,因此有不少互聯網公司都瞄準了這一方向。
三星、索尼都推出了基于NuttX的物聯網系統(tǒng),國內阿里巴巴、騰訊也立馬跟上。阿里巴巴旗下擁有面向IoT領域的輕量級物聯網嵌入式操作系統(tǒng)——AliOS Things,截止到目前搭載其操作系統(tǒng)的芯片出貨量已達上億片,正在廣泛應用于智能穿戴、智能家電、智慧城市、工業(yè)物聯網等場景。騰訊也有自己的物聯網操作系統(tǒng)——TecentOS tiny,該系統(tǒng)于2019年7月對外發(fā)布,10月開源,主要是幫助芯片、模組、硬件廠商簡化物聯網終端開發(fā),快速連接上云。
▲ 物聯網系統(tǒng)是大勢所趨
此外,華為在鴻蒙系統(tǒng)推出之前就有物聯網系統(tǒng)liteOS,前不久發(fā)布的鴻蒙2.0系統(tǒng)也在liteOS 基礎上大幅改動,目前已經可以適配大部分物聯網設備。無論是硬件企業(yè)還是軟件公司,發(fā)展物聯網操作系統(tǒng)都是大勢所趨,小米Vela則在這個趨勢上再一把火,讓物聯網操作系統(tǒng)領域更加熱鬧。
小米物聯網操作系統(tǒng)的優(yōu)勢
在眾多競爭者中,小米的步子邁得比較晚,不過小米有自己獨特的優(yōu)勢。一方面,小米在智能家居領域布局早,已有數億消費者成為小米智能家居用戶,這些用戶都是小米物聯網操作系統(tǒng)潛在使用者。
▲ 小米物聯網操作系統(tǒng)架構
另一方面,小米有著完整的系統(tǒng)架構。底層是NuttX內核,提供最基本的任務調度、跨進程間通信、文件系統(tǒng)等基礎OS功能,同時也提供簡潔高效的設備驅動和電源管理等組件。中層是Vela應用框架,是為擴展系統(tǒng)服務提供的通用框架,包括藍牙通信組件、通信組件、OTA服務、數據本地存儲服務,以及對圖形用戶界面和腳本語言的支持,上層主要是針對不同的物聯網應用開發(fā)。
通過三層架構,小米可以在短時間內容構建出物聯網操作系統(tǒng)框架,據小米官網宣稱,已經有3800家企業(yè)參與小米IoT平臺開發(fā),未來小米只需要擴大生態(tài),優(yōu)化底層與中層系統(tǒng),就能和華為鴻蒙、AliOS Things等物聯網操作系統(tǒng)一較高下。
隨著2020年即將結束,5G網絡即將進入第三個年頭,雖然仍舊看不到5G 對人們生活的改變,但是5G 物聯網構建的萬物互聯思想已經逐漸在人們心中萌芽。智能插座、智能掃地機器人、智能音箱出貨量逐年提高,這些都是5G 萬物互聯的基礎。小黑相信在不久的將來萬物互聯時代將給我們生活帶來翻天覆地的變化,小米Vela等操作系統(tǒng)也會大顯神威。
圖源:小米官網、小米iot

請輸入評論內容...
請輸入評論/評論長度6~500個字
最新活動更多
-
7月8日立即報名>> 【在線會議】英飛凌新一代智能照明方案賦能綠色建筑與工業(yè)互聯
-
7月22-29日立即報名>> 【線下論壇】第三屆安富利汽車生態(tài)圈峰會
-
7.30-8.1火熱報名中>> 全數會2025(第六屆)機器人及智能工廠展
-
7月31日免費預約>> OFweek 2025具身智能機器人產業(yè)技術創(chuàng)新應用論壇
-
免費參會立即報名>> 7月30日- 8月1日 2025全數會工業(yè)芯片與傳感儀表展
-
即日-2025.8.1立即下載>> 《2024智能制造產業(yè)高端化、智能化、綠色化發(fā)展藍皮書》
推薦專題